My property is covered in quartz.
Best pic I could take of his one, you can see my fingers with the transparency.
Although it doesn't look like it, if this one was polished it would be as clear as glass (cleanest one I've found).
Most are shades of pink or are milky white.

Sent a couple to a friend who has a rock saw for geodes, but they just shattered.

Narrows probably going to have flood warning in December or too high, but who knows you could get lucky. I used my normal shoes (NB Minimus) with no socks and was fine. I'd do neoprene socks if it was cold. West Rim to Angels Landing is good, so is Emerald Pools. Hard to go wrong. IDK anything about camping in the park I camped in BLM outside the park off Kolob Reservoir Road.

A hunter in Tennessee took down a monstrous and perhaps record-breaking 47-point buck.

Stephen Tucker, 26, shot the deer while muzzleloader hunting in Sumner County, Tenn. The deer’s antlers totaled more than 300 inches in length, the Tennessee Wildlife Resources Agency (TWRA) said.

Dale Grandstaff, a captain with the TWRA measured the animal by using the Boone & Crockett Club requirements for non-typical racks, WWMT.com writes.

The buck earned a “green score” of 313 2/8 inches, but after necessary reductions as declared by Boone & Crockett, it finished with a net score of 308 3/8 inches.

WWMT notes that the state record (from the same county) is 244 3/8 inches. The larger record for free-ranging white-tailed buck harvested by a hunter with a muzzleloader is an animal whose antlers measured 307 5/8 inches, from 2003 in Iowa.

The same report notes that due to a 60-day “drying period,” the antlers could shrink beneath the world record status.

The antlers from Tucker’s deer will be measured in January.

“That is something you just don’t ever expect to measure as a certified scorer,” Grandstaff said, according to WWMT.

If Grandstaff’s measurements are acceptable, the antlers will be measured again in spring 2019 during a Boone & Crockett banquet. Scorers will then decide if the January measurements will hold up, WWMT concludes.
